Title : Instructional Designer II
Location: Remote
Duration: 4 Months with possibility of extending
Pay Rate : $60-$65/hr 
Key Responsibilities
•    Apply adult learning and instructional design principles to develop high-impact sales training content grounded in real AM workflows
•    Author, edit, and review enablement content ensuring accuracy and clarity.
•    Manage project level enablement operations — maintain system hygiene, track certifications, update learning repositories, and manage translation and version control processes.
•    Measure program effectiveness using sales performance data, learner feedback, and adoption analytics; synthesize insights to drive continuous improvement.
•    Support virtual and live facilitation where needed, fostering interactive learning, peer exchange, and the practical application of selling skills
Required Qualifications
•    2–4 years of experience in Sales Enablement, Learning Design, or Sales Training, ideally with exposure to direct selling or AM roles.
•    Formal education, certification, or training in Instructional Design, Adult Learning, or Learning Experience Design and the ability to create programs that drive skill application and behavior change
•    Proven success building or facilitating sales training for expansion-focused teams
•    Strong project management skills, capable of organizing multiple initiatives concurrently
•    Language fluency (read, write, speak, and review content) in at least one of the following: Spanish (LATAM), German, French (European), Japanese, or Taiwanese
•    Ability to adapt content and facilitation styles for culturally diverse or region-specific audiences
•    Experience using learning analytics or performance metrics to evaluate and iterate on program effectiveness
•    Proficiency with learning design tools and systems, such as Rise, Seismic, Articulate, Captivate, or Figma, and presentation tools like Google Slides
Preferred Qualifications
•    Excellent communicator with presence and credibility among sales audiences.
•    Background in GTM or revenue enablement within high-growth, fast-paced environments.
•    Experience as a former Account Manager or client success professional

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
